Closing Costs for Homebuyers in Redford, Michigan
What Are Closing Costs?
Closing costs are the fees and expenses associated with finalizing a real estate transaction. According to Sonic Title experts in Metro Detroit, these costs typically range from 2-5% of the purchase price of a home. For a median-priced home in Redford, this could mean paying between $4,900 and $12,250, depending on the neighborhood.
Buyer's Closing Costs Breakdown
Buyers in Redford can expect to encounter several specific costs when closing on a home. A common question we hear at Sonic Title is: "What exactly are these costs composed of?" The answer is they generally include:
- Loan origination fees: Charged by the lender for processing the loan application.
- Appraisal fees: To assess the value of the property.
- Inspection fees: For a professional home inspection.
- Title insurance: Covers any title defects or liens.
- Prepaid expenses: Such as homeowner's insurance and property taxes.

Seller's Closing Costs (for Context)
Sellers in Redford also incur closing costs, typically including real estate agent commissions, transfer taxes, and any repairs agreed upon in the sales contract. While these costs are separate from the buyer's, understanding them can provide a complete picture of the transaction.
Michigan-Specific Costs
In Michigan, specific costs such as transfer taxes and recording fees are common. According to Sonic Title, these can add a few hundred dollars to the total closing costs. Always factor in these costs when budgeting for your home purchase in Redford.

Negotiating Closing Costs
Buyers often wonder if closing costs are negotiable. The answer is yes. Negotiating can sometimes lead to sellers covering a portion of these costs. Sonic Title suggests engaging a knowledgeable real estate agent to help navigate these negotiations.
Seller Concessions
Seller concessions are contributions the seller makes towards the buyer's closing costs. These can be a strategic way to reduce out-of-pocket expenses for buyers. Understanding when and how to ask for concessions can be a valuable tool in your home buying process.
Cash to Close vs Closing Costs
A common point of confusion is the difference between cash to close and closing costs. Cash to close is the total amount you need to bring to the closing table, which includes closing costs and any down payment. Clarifying these terms with your lender can prevent surprises at closing.
Sample Closing Cost Worksheet for Redford
Creating a closing cost worksheet is an effective way to organize and anticipate expenses. Here's a sample breakdown:
- Home Price: $245,000 (example)
- Estimated Closing Costs (2-5%): $4,900 - $12,250
- Loan Origination Fee: $2,450
- Appraisal Fee: $500
- Inspection Fee: $400
- Title Insurance: $1,000
- Transfer Taxes: $500
- Recording Fees: $150
